Subject: [KVM PATCH v9 0/5] irqfd fixes and enhancements
Date: Thu, 02 Jul 2009 11:37:55 -0400 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20090702153454.20186.99191.stgit@dev.haskins.net> (raw)
(Applies to kvm.git/master:1f9050fd)
The following is the latest attempt to fix the races in irqfd/eventfd, as
well as restore DEASSIGN support. For more details, please read the patch
headers.
As always, this series has been tested against the kvm-eventfd unit test
and everything appears to be functioning properly. You can download this
test here:

[Changelog:
v9:
*) Re-split v8:1/3 into v9[1/5, 2/5, 3/5]
*) Fixed bad error handing in 3/5
*) Changed "init" bitfield in 5/5 to a bool
*) Rebased to kvm.git/master:1f9050fd)
v8:
*) Rebased to kvm.git/master:beeaacd1)
*) Dropped Davide's patch (2/5 in v7) since it's now upstream
*) Folded v7's 1/5 and 3/5 together, and added a single
eventfd hunk to convert wake_up_locked_polled to wake_up_polled
*) Dropped irqfd->active bit in favor of irqfd_is_active() function
*) Cleaned up comments in 1/3
*) Dropped v7's 5/5 (slow-work)
*) Added new patch (3/3) which makes the cleanup-wq's creation
dynamic so to avoid the resource penalty for guests that do
not use irqfd.
v7:
*) Addressed minor-nit feedback from Michael
*) Cleaned up patch headers
*) Re-added separate slow-work feature patch to end for comparison
v6:
*) Removed slow-work in favor of using a dedicated single-thread
workqueue.
*) Condensed cleanup path to always use deferred shutdown
*) Saved about 56 lines over v5, with the following diffstat:
include/linux/kvm_host.h | 2
virt/kvm/eventfd.c | 248 ++++++++++++++++++-----------------------------
2 files changed, 97 insertions(+), 153 deletions(-)
v5:
Untracked..
]
